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Reading In Motion show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:

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Reading In Motion's revenue has declined by 32.6%, moving from $1.5M to $983K. Total assets increased by 19% over the same period, from $515K to $612K. Total functional expenses fell by 27.9%, from $1.4M to $1.0M. In its most recent filing year (2023), Reading In Motion reported a deficit of $50K,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$115K in liabilities against $612K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 18.7%), resulting in net assets of $498K.
